We compared two laptop CPUs: Intel Processor N200 with 4 cores 1.0GHz and Intel Pentium N3700 with 4 cores 1.6GHz . You will find out which processor performs better in benchmark tests, key specifications, power consumption and more.
Main Differences
Intel Processor N200 's Advantages
Released 7 years and 10 months late
Higher specification of memory (4800 vs 1600)
Larger memory bandwidth (38.4GB/s vs 25.6GB/s)
Newer PCIe version (3.0 vs 2.0)
More modern manufacturing process (10nm vs 14nm)
